Lost another
Those of us here on the Left coast lost another old school racer and swap meet vendor. Jack Corley of Portland Oregon has passed away. Was an avid v8 60 race car guy and Old Ford parts source seems like forever. I personally knew him since at least the late 1960s when I first met him at the Portland Swap Meet. Will miss chatting with him, his blue shop coat and flat top hair cut.
